Estee Illuminates
To commemorate Breast Cancer Awareness Month, The Estee Lauder Companies‘ Breast Cancer Awareness Campaign illuminated a total of 38 global historic landmarks in pink lights over a 24-hour period of time, creating a new category and achieving a new Guinness World Record entitled: “Most Landmarks Illuminated for a Cause in 24 Hours.” The 24-hour period began at 12:00 pm EST on Thursday, September 30 and ended 12:00 pm EST on Friday, October 1. Guinness World Records made this official announcement on October 1, as Evelyn H. Lauder, Senior Corporate Vice President of The Estee Lauder Companies, and Elizabeth Hurley, Spokesmodel for Estee Lauder and The Breast Cancer Awareness Campaign, illuminated the Empire State Building in pink lights, commemorating an effort that began 11 years ago at the same New York City landmark.

Georgia-Pacific Celebrates All Susan G. Komen Race for the Cure® Volunteers
With more than 100,000 volunteers participating in Komen Races across the country, volunteers serve as the backbone of the series, helping to put on more than 120 Race events each year. Georgia-Pacific recognizes the hard work and dedication of the volunteers and created the Quilted Northern Soft & Strong® Champions campaign to recognize race volunteers and everyone else that lends a helping hand in supporting Susan G. Komen for the Cure. Whether it’s working at a Race or leaving an encouraging note for loved ones online, anyone can be a Quilted Northern Soft & Strong® Champion.
The Susan G. Komen Race for the Cure® is the largest series of 5K runs/fitness walks in the world, with 1.5 million participants each year. The Komen Race for the Cure Series raises significant funds and awareness for the fight against breast cancer, celebrates breast cancer survivorship and honors those who have lost their battle with the disease. In 2010 and 2011, Georgia-Pacific has committed to donating $225,000 to Susan G. Komen for the Cure®.
“At Georgia-Pacific, we are excited about our seventh year as a sponsor of the Susan G. Komen Race for the Cure® Series and wish to celebrate all those who bond together to help support and honor those affected by breast cancer,” said Anna Umphress of Georgia-Pacific. “To show our commitment to finding a cure, we are the official sponsor of volunteers of over 120 Komen Race for the Cure events held in the U.S.”

ULTA Windows of Love Campaign(TM) to Show Support in 369 Store Windows Across the Country
Throughout the month of October, Breast Cancer Awareness Month, the windows at ULTA stores across the country will be covered in “Love Letters” as part of its Windows of Love(TM) campaign to support breast cancer awareness and research. The program showcases letters written by women, containing messages of hope, support and inspiration, in store windows at ULTA’s 369 locations nationwide. The campaign is designed to create a visual testament to the power of women helping women in the battle against breast cancer.
ULTA will provide three additional ways for women to help raise funds for The Breast Cancer Research Foundation®:
— Those who donate $1 can register for a chance to win a beauty bag of
pink ribbon products; one winner per store will be chosen by random
drawing.
— Those who make a contribution of $5 or more can receive their choice of
a pink ribbon umbrella or tote bag.*
— Those who visit ulta.com can make a donation to fund hours of breast
cancer research via The Breast Cancer Research Foundation’s® Time for
Research(TM) program.
